19 | Objective of the Course: | It is aimed to get to know herself and the society more closely with her observation ability and to evaluate the role on the stage in the light of information. |
20 | Contribution of the Course to Professional Development | At the end of the training given in this course, the student is expected to be able to apply basic acting techniques. |

22 | Course Content: |
Week | Theoretical | Practical |
1 | Practices to ensure group dynamism | Practices to ensure group dynamism |
2 | animal training | animal training |
3 | Dual animal training | Dual animal training |
4 | Transformation practices | Transformation practices |
5 | Concentration, Concentration practices | Concentration, Concentration practices |
6 | Units and objectives exercises | Units and objectives exercises |
7 | Internal action practices | Internal action practices |
8 | Internal action practices | Internal action practices |
9 | Improvisation | Improvisation |
10 | Improvisation | Improvisation |
11 | Improvisation | Improvisation |
12 | Collective works Encouraging decision making, Orientation to take responsibility. | Collective works Encouraging decision making, Orientation to take responsibility. |
13 | Collective works Encouraging decision making, Orientation to take responsibility. | Collective works Encouraging decision making, Orientation to take responsibility. |
14 | homework presentation | homework presentation |
